well it's sorted. when i drove it home on friday, i came via the a15 (50ish mph) and a180m (70ish mph) for about an hr... went out to it saturday morning started fine. drove to the railway and left it their from 8 till 6pm, very slow to start. so took it for a run up to laceby and back home. went out to i this morning and it really only just started, so took it to halford's (trade card bitch's ) and they checked the charge FOC (nice one halford's) and it came as this, no load 12.06 so not looking good for the alternator but with load (light's/heated screen/etc) it came back with load, 13.95 so WTF is going on. so got a few bit's from them, screen wash, and a battery charger (just in case for monday morning at 5.30 am) and thought about it. and it kept coming back to the same thing, earth's, as to be blunt these honda's the earth system is sh!t....... got home, stuck it on charge, and pulled the rocker cover/slam panel one off, cleaned/greased and back on, same with the battery to body strap, but the best one was the gearbox to O/S chassis rail. started to pull the airbox off, (ITR) airbox was bolted to the same bolt as the earth strap, which snapped, , got the air box out of the way, and got the bolt out body, cleaned that up and bolted the body one back it. and bolted the other side back on directly in to the gear box. also took the oppertunity to pull a starter bolt out and grease it up as well. it now start's up like new, and i also think the head light's are a bit better as well.

back in october, i put a new battery on her, as she was getting a bit sluggish to start, it was a bosch s4 rated at 330 amp, on tuesday i noticed that again it was sluugush to start, so page's who i bought the battery off, tested it it came back at 12.54V, 235 amp's, and a total life of 66%. so that got replaced and it was back to normal, so sorted. or not again this morning at 6am i went out to go to work, went to start it and it only just started. didn't have chance to drop test the battery today, but i'm just hoping it's a dud battery again, i just hope it isn't the alternator or starter giving up, went to start it tonight, and when cranking over, you can hear the main relay clicking away..... any thought's people?... (i'm am gonna look at the charge rate and what not tommorow...)
